  • Patent number: 7065809
    Abstract: A cushion including any number of upholstery ornaments positioned in recessed and non-rotatable locations on the cushion is provided. The cushion filler is formed of a soft, flexible and relatively low-stiffness foam material that includes one or more inserts formed of a flexible, relatively high-stiffness material and has one or more rigid securing plates secured to the cushion filler. An upholstery cover including holes or recesses and holes aligned with openings in the inserts is placed over the cushion filler and secured to a suitable base or frame. The ornaments are positioned in the holes in the upholstery cover and openings in the inserts which provide recesses in the upper surface of the cushion into which the ornaments can be drawn and secured to the rigid securing plates to provide a recessed, non-rotating and aesthetically pleasing appearance to the cushion.
